Overview
EN IEC 62841-2-22:2025/A11:2025 is a key European amendment standard issued by CLC (CENELEC) that addresses the safety requirements for electric motor-operated hand-held cut-off machines. This amendment provides updates and clarifications to the existing European Standard EN IEC 62841-2-22:2025, ensuring enhanced safety for a wide range of portable tools, transportable tools, and lawn and garden machinery. The standard is an essential part of the EN IEC 62841 series, aligning with EU machinery safety directives and industry best practices for electric tools used in cutting and construction applications.
Key Topics
Enhanced Marking and Instructions
Updates to labeling and instruction requirements ensure that users have access to clear and accurate safety information, improving proper tool operation and maintenance.Moisture Resistance Improvements
Revisions to moisture resistance clauses contribute to better durability and safety of hand-held cut-off machines in varying work environments.Construction Requirements
Additions clarify construction standards, particularly concerning battery-operated tools, and introduce requirements for devices that prevent unintentional operation during servicing or maintenance.Supply Cord Modifications
New specifications regarding flexible cords, particularly for tools with a rated capacity greater than 155 mm, require the use of robust cord types (such as heavy polychloroprene or PUR sheathed cords) to withstand demanding job site conditions.Noise and Vibration Emission Measurements
Updates to noise and vibration test methods provide more precise measurement criteria, supporting workplace health and safety initiatives.Battery Tool Safety
Expanded requirements for isolation and disabling devices in battery-powered tools help prevent accidental activation, aligning these products with the latest safety innovations.Legislative Alignment
The standard strengthens conformity with the essential health and safety requirements of EU Directive 2006/42/EC (Machinery Directive), ensuring tools certified under this amendment can be marketed across the EU with presumption of conformity.

European foreword
This document (EN IEC 62841-2-22:2025/A11:2025) has been prepared by CLC/TC 116 “Safety and
environmental aspects of motor-operated electric tools”.
The following dates are fixed:
• latest date by which this document has to be (dop) 2026-12-31
implemented at national level by publication of
an identical national standard or by
endorsement
• latest date by which the national standards (dow) 2029-12-31
conflicting with this document have to be
withdrawn
This document modifies by common modifications EN IEC 62841-2-22:2025, which consists of the text of
116/870/FDIS (future IEC 62841-2-22, Ed. 1) prepared by IEC/TC 116 “Safety of motor-operated electric tools”.
Attention is drawn to the possibility that some of the elements of this document may be the subject of patent
rights. CENELEC shall not be held responsible for identifying any or all such patent rights.
This series is divided into four parts.
Part 1: General requirements which are common to most hand-held electric motor operated tools (for the
purpose of this document referred to simply as tools) which could come within the scope of this document;
Part 2, 3 or 4: Requirements for particular types of tools which either supplement or modify the requirements
given in Part 1 to account for the particular hazards and characteristics of these specific tools.
Part 2-22 is used in conjunction with EN 62841-1:2015 and all of its amendments and corrigenda (if any).
Part 2-22 supplements or modifies the corresponding clauses in EN 62841-1:2015 and its amendments, so as
to convert it into the European Standard: Particular requirements for hand-held cut-off machines.
Where a particular subclause of Part 1 is not mentioned in the Part 2-22, that subclause applies as far as
relevant. When this document states “addition”, “modification” or “replacement”, the relevant text in Part 1 is to
be adapted accordingly.
The following print types are used:
— requirements; in roman type;
— test specifications: in italic type;
— notes: in smaller roman type.
The terms defined in Clause 3 are printed in bold typeface.
Subclauses, notes, tables and figures which are additional to those in Part 1 are numbered starting from 101.
Clauses, subclauses, notes, tables, figures and annexes which are additional to those in IEC 62841-2-22:2025
are prefixed “Z”.
This document follows the overall requirements of EN ISO 12100.
This document has been prepared under a standardization request addressed to CENELEC by the European
Commission. The Standing Committee of the EFTA States subsequently approves these requests for its
Member States.
For relationship with EU Legislation, see informative Annex ZZ, which is an integral part of this document.
Compliance with the clauses of Part 1 together with Part 2-22 provides one means of conforming with the
essential health and safety requirements of the Directive concerned.
Any feedback and questions on this document should be directed to the users’ national committee. A complete
listing of these bodies can be found on the CENELEC website.
1 Modification to Clause 8, “Marking and instructions”
Delete NOTE 101 in subclause 8.2.
2 Modification to Clause 14, “Moisture resistance”
Delete NOTE 2 and NOTE 3 in subclause 14.5.
3 Addition to Clause 21, “Construction”
Delete NOTE 101 in subclause 21.18.1.
4 Modifications to Clause 24 “Supply connection and external flexible cords”
Replace the existing subclause 24.4 with the following:
“For tools with a rated capacity greater than 155 mm, the supply cord shall be not lighter than heavy
polychloroprene or PUR sheathed flexible cord (code designation 60245 IEC 66, H07RN-F or H07BQ-F) or
equivalent.
Compliance is checked by inspection and by measurement.”
